Serum and salivary oxidative analysis in Complex Regional Pain Syndrome.

Although both inflammatory and neural mechanisms have been suggested as potential contributors to Complex Regional Pain Syndrome type I (CRPS-I), the pathogenesis of the syndrome is still unclear. Clinical trials have shown that free radical scavengers can reduce signs and symptoms of CRPS-I, indirectly suggesting that free radicals and increased oxidative stress are involved in the pathogenesis of CRPS-I. This study investigated this premise by determining the levels of antioxidants in the serum and saliva of 31 patients with CRPS-I and in a control group of 21 healthy volunteers. Serum lipid peroxidation products (MDA) and all antioxidative parameters analyzed were significantly elevated in CRPS-I patients: median salivary peroxidase and superoxide dismutase (SOD) activity values, uric acid (UA) concentration and total antioxidant status (TAS) values were higher in CRPS-I patients by 150% (p=0.01), 280% (p=0.04), 60% (p=0.0001), and 200% (p=0.0003), respectively, as compared with controls. Similar although not as extensive pattern of oxidative changes were found in the serum: mean serum UA and MDA concentrations and TAS value in the CRPS-I patients were higher by 16% (p=0.04), 25% (p=0.02), and 22% (p=0.05), respectively, than in the controls. Additionally, median salivary albumin concentration and median salivary LDH activities in the patients were 2.5 times (p=0.001) and 3.1 (p=0.004) times higher than in the controls. The accumulated data show that free radicals are involved in the pathophysiology of CRPS-I, which is reflected both in serum and salivary analyses. These data could be used for both diagnostic and therapeutic purposes in CRPS-I patients.
